Ethos Financial Group LLC purchased a new stake in Rivian Automotive, Inc. (NASDAQ:RIVN - Free Report) in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und purchased 25,000 shares of the electric vehicle automaker's stock, valued at approximately $311,000.
Several other large investors also recently added to or reduced their stakes in RIVN. Teacher Retirement System of Texas acquired a new stake in Rivian Automotive in the 1st quarter valued at approximately $1,382,000. Twinbeech Capital LP bought a new position in shares of Rivian Automotive during the 4th quarter worth about $29,944,000. Caisse Des Depots ET Consignations bought a new position in shares of Rivian Automotive during the 1st quarter worth about $2,807,000. Symmetry Investments LP bought a new position in shares of Rivian Automotive during the 4th quarter worth about $357,000. Finally, Mmbg Investment Advisors CO. bought a new position in Rivian Automotive during the first quarter worth about $274,000. 66.25% of the stock is owned by institutional investors.
Insider Buying and Selling
In other news, CFO Claire Mcdonough sold 7,247 shares of Rivian Automotive st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, August 18th. The stock was sold at an average price of $12.28, for a total transaction of $88,993.16.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ief financial officer directly owned 789,445 shares in the company, valued at approximately $9,694,384.60. The trade was a 0.91%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which can be accessed through this link. Insiders own 2.16% of the company's stock.
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ades
A number of research analysts have issued reports on RIVN shares. Stifel Nicolaus cut their price objective on Rivian Automotive from $18.00 to $16.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a report on Friday, August 8th. Canaccord Genuity Group dropped their target price on shares of Rivian Automotive from $23.00 to $21.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a research note on Wednesday, August 6th. Wells Fargo & Company dropped their price objective on shares of Rivian Automotive from $14.00 to $13.00 and set an "equal weight" r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, May 7th. Jefferies Financial Group restated a "hold" rating and issued a $16.00 price objective on shares of Rivian Automotive in a research report on Wednesday, May 14th. Finally, JPMorgan Chase & Co. dropped their target price on Rivian Automotive from $10.00 to $9.00 and set an "underweight" r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, August 6th. Five equ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, eighteen have issued a Hold rating and three have assigned a Sell rating to the company. According to MarketBeat, the company has a consensus rating of "Hold" and an average target price of $13.69.

Rivian Automotive Price Performance
Shares of NASDAQ:RIVN traded down $0.16 during mid-day trading on Tuesday, reaching $12.25. 48,665,049 shares of the st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 41,325,416. Rivian Automotive, Inc. has a one year low of $9.50 and a one year high of $17.15. The stock's 50 day simple moving average is $13.09 and its 200-day simple moving average is $12.94. The company has a quick ratio of 2.72, a current ratio of 3.44 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.73.
Rivian Automotive (NASDAQ:RIVN -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 5th. The electric vehicle automaker reported ($0.97) ear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.65) by ($0.32). The business had revenue of $1.30 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.27 billion. Rivian Automotive had a negative return on equity of 58.07% and a negative net margin of 68.06%.Rivian Automotive's revenue was up 12.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ned ($1.46) earnings per share. On average, analysts predict that Rivian Automotive, Inc. will post -3.2 EPS for the current year.

Rivian Automotive,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, manufactures, and sells electric vehicles and accessories. The company offers consumer vehicles, including a two-row, five-passenger pickup truck under the R1T brand, a three-row, seven-passenger sport utility vehicle under the R1S name.
